Gene Klein (born Chaim Witz (Hebrew: חיים ויץ‎, <small style="margin: 0px; padding: 0px; border: 0px; font-stretch: inherit; line-height: inherit; font-size: 16px; vertical-align: baseline; background-image: none;"></small>[xaˈim ˈvit͡s]; born August 25, 1949), known professionally as Gene Simmons, is an Israeli-American musician, singer, songwriter, record producer, entrepreneur, actor, author and television personality of Hungarian-Jewishdescent. Also known by his stage persona The Demon, he is the bassist and co-lead singer of Kiss, the rock band he co-founded with lead singer and rhythm guitarist Paul Stanley in the early 1970s.
